Why www.?
« on: Feb 26th, 2006, 9:49am »
Quote Quote  Modify Modify

Can anyone explain to me why when i go to some websites i can type the name without the "www" in front and get directed to the site.  But on others, if I don't type the "www", I get redirected to a search page.  So, 2 questions.  Why does this happen and how do I ensure my site functions as the former example and not the latter?  Thank you.

This happens because the web site administrator hasn't configured his site settings properly. I don't know of any good solution other than making sure you type "www." when the site requires it.
